How to fill out new patient registration packet
How to fill out New Patient Registration Packet
01
Begin by entering your personal information, including your full name, date of birth, and contact details.
02
Provide your insurance information, including the name of the insurance company and policy number.
03
Fill out your medical history, including previous surgeries, allergies, and current medications.
04
Complete the section about your primary care physician, including their contact information.
05
Review the consent forms and provide your signature and date.
06
Submit the completed packet to the front desk or designated office personnel.

How long is a new patient visit?
Office or other outpatient visit for the evaluation and management of a new patient, which requires a medically appropriate history and/or examination and moderate level of medical decision making. When using time for code selection, 45-59 minutes of total time is spent on the date of the encounter.

What is a new patient appointment?
New Patient Visits are used to “establish care” at a new clinic, and are required before you can receive any referrals, treatments, medication refills, etc. This also ensures we have all your vital health information before making important medical decisions on your behalf.

What is included in patient registration?
Patient registration is typically the first point of contact between a patient and a healthcare facility. It involves the completion of various forms and documents, including patient intake forms, insurance verification forms, consent forms, and financial responsibility agreements.
How to fill out a patient registration form?
A patient registration form typically includes the following particulars to be filled by the patient: Name, contact details, address. Insurance details. Social security number. Details of emergency contact. Purpose of visit. Over-the-counter medications. Health goals. Medical history.

What does a doctor do on your first visit?
Primary care providers usually check your heart rate and blood pressure as well as complete a visual exam of your body to search for any warning signs of health problems. Depending on the results of the exam and any lifestyle factors or medical history, they may perform other tests as well.
